im not sure if this is anxiety

hi everyone i really need help. about 6 months ago i had an episode where i felt this rush of heat surge through my body.. and i almost passed out.. i felt nausous and very scared. i kept getting the heat rush for about 2 hours on and off. this happened for about 2 months every few days. then it stopped.. it has been about 2 months and i have had NOTHING until about a week ago.. now its been daily for the past 5 days. i get the rush of heat in my body i feel faint and my chest feels tight. i feel like my throat is closing up. i feel like i cant breathe correctly. and i get heart patipilations too.. please help if anyone has ever had this.. everyone keeps saying it anxiety but it just doesnt feel right and its been going on for days again.. im so scared..

Yes you are experiencing a panic attack, my first panic attack was exactly like you're describing.  I have only had one because I talk myself down from them when I feel antsy.  When you feel like your going to have one, try breathing in deep, hold your hand against your stomach, feel your stomach expand with the breath, open your mouth and breath out slowly.  Do this a few times, it will help calm you down.  Are you on any meds to help you cope with anxiety and panic?  If not, you should consider it, I'm on Prozac and Clonazapam.
